 fit-PC1 (ENC-iGLX) Computer                

Not recommended for new designs. Use fit-PC2 instead.

ENC-iGLX

ENC-iGLX Highlights
Full-featured tiny PC, based on CompuLab's SBC-iGLX board
AMD LX800 CPU @ 500 MHz
256 MB DDR
60GB Hard disk
Dual 100 Mbps Ethernet
SXGA graphics controller for flat panel monitor
Two USB ports
Speaker and microphone interface
RS-232 serial port
Single 5V supply, 3-5 watt, fanless operation
Size: 120 x 116 x 40 mm
The ENC-iGLX is a tiny PC computer based on AMD's Geode LX processor. It runs Windows XP and Linux. The ENC-iGLX's unique advantages comprise exceptionally small size, quiet fanless operation and very low power consumption. With a price as low as $295, it makes an ideal solution for applications such as point-of-sale, internet kiosks, classroom computers and even specialized routers.
The ENC-iGLX's enclosure is made from aluminum, rugged and splash / dust resistant.
